Page 4 sur 5

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 02 déc. 2017, 12:06
par jean88
En faite ce qui serait bien de savoir c'est :
- si le problème vient de nous (mauvais paramétrage)
- si c'est lié au fait que le plugin soit non fonctionnel (cf. l'indication sur le market)

Dans le cas de la seconde option je pense qu'un peu de communication sur le sujet de la part du développeur serait la bien venue.
A minima pour savoir s'il est envisagé de résoudre le problème (si c'est faisable et à quelle échéance ?) ou si on peut le contourner (création manuelle des tags ?).

Je sais que tout le monde est très occupé mais l'absence de communication créée l’incompréhension.

Merci d'avance.
Jean

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 05 déc. 2017, 22:56
par jean88
Up

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 07 déc. 2017, 19:00
par gunzo1982
Pareil pour moi, j ai bien l id du tag qui s affiche dans les logs suivi d’une ligne avec la valeur « null ».

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 10 déc. 2017, 12:07
par jean88
Lunarok, tu peux nous répondre stp ?

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 13 déc. 2017, 18:31
par jean88
Pas de réponse ? Plugin plus maintenu ?

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 18 déc. 2017, 21:56
par jean88
UP

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 21 déc. 2017, 21:12
par jean88
UP

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 22 déc. 2017, 16:13
par jean88
Bonjour,

Bon toujours pas de réponse du dev, pourtant il passe presque tous les jours sur le forum.

En attendant j'ai essayé de troubleshooter.

Dans le fichier /var/www/html/plugins/nfc/node/nfc.js il a ce bloc de code :

Code : Tout sélectionner

var nfcdev = new nfc.NFC();
nfcdev.on('read', function(tag) {
	console.log((new Date()) + " : Tag " + tag.uid);
  url = urlJeedom + "&type=nfc&name=" + name + "&uid=" + tag.uid;
	request({
		url: url,
		method: 'PUT'
	},

	function (error, response, body) {
			if (!error && response.statusCode == 200) {
			//console.log( response.statusCode);
			}else{
				console.log( error );
			}
		});
}).start();


c'est dans cette partie
console.log((new Date()) + " : Tag " + tag.uid);
que cela écrit le tag sur le log.

Je me demandait à quoi correspondait la ligne "null" dans le log.
Il semble que cela vienne du bloc fonction dans la partie basse du code.
La condition
if (!error && response.statusCode == 200)
n'est pas respecté non pas à cause de "error" mais de code de réponse qui n'est pas 200 mais 500 en l'affichant.
Pour le savoir j'ai remplacé
console.log( error );
par
console.log( error + " " +response.statusCode);
Résultat :

Code : Tout sélectionner

Fri Dec 22 2017 14:53:25 GMT+0000 (UTC) : Tag aa:bb:cc:dd
null 500
Bon maintenant reste à savoir pourquoi on a le code 500 (erreur interne) et pas le code 200 ...
La seule piste que j'ai c'est le warn dans l'installation du plugin :
npm WARN enoent ENOENT: no such file or directory, open '/var/www/html/plugins/nfc/node/package.json'
Vu qu'une erreur 500 peut venir d'un fichier manquant ou d'un chemin erroné ...

Affaire à suivre

Jean

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 22 déc. 2017, 17:26
par lood9
Plugin mort et pourtant encore sur le store ?!

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 13 janv. 2018, 11:59
par jean88
Bonjour à tous,
Depuis la dernière MAJ : 2018-01-12 04:10:30 le mode inclusion est fonctionnel !!!
Merci Lunarok :D

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 13 janv. 2018, 16:36
par Fil
Bonne nouvelle.

Le plugin est-il complètement opérationnel chez vous ?
Chez moi il ne détecte plus les tags au bout d'un certain temps....

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 13 janv. 2018, 19:15
par jean88
Oui en effet, après un certains temps les tags ne sont plus détectés ...
Il faut redémarrer le démon pour qu'ils soient détectés à nouveau.
Seule différence au niveau des logs (Nfc_node) : les tags n'apparaissent pas.

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 14 janv. 2018, 08:05
par Fil
Nouveau test et même constat ce matin... démon à relancer.
Les changements d'état sont également très long, peut-être à cause du lecteur...

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 14 janv. 2018, 13:50
par jean88
Pour éviter les problèmes, j'ai mis un scénario qui relance le deamon toute les heures.
Pour le changement d'état c'est vrai qu'il faut bien laisser le tag en contant jusqu'à 2 ou 3 pour être sur de la prise en compte.
Pas sur que cela vienne du lecteur car quand je faisais les tests pour l'inclusion je laissais le tag à peine une demi seconde et il apparaissait dans les logs.

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 20 oct. 2018, 20:42
par Seb54
bonjour à tous, je déterre ce fil pour savoir si vous pouvez m'aider svp pour un probleme matériel.

Mon Pi3 ne reconnais pas le lecteur ACR122U, qu'il soit en USB sur le pi ou sur un hub : pas de led allumée sur le lecteur.

edit : j'ai supprimé de ce post le probleme des dépendances, finalement hors sujet, rien à voir avec le lecture non reconnu (dépendances résulues avec ce fil : viewtopic.php?t=28723)

Quelqu'un a déjà eu ce problème?

nota : le lecteur est bien reconnu, led rouge allumée, sur un PC

merci

edit : mon hub est alimenté aussi. Un pb elec peut il expliquer le phénomène? si oui comment le résoudre? j'ai dejà une alim 3000mA pourtant, merci

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 24 oct. 2018, 22:09
par Seb54
petit up svp, je ne trouve vraiment rien en ligne, ce lecteur me fait tourner en bourrique, faut il le préparer sur PC avant de le brancher sur Jeedom?
merci!

Edit : je me réponds à moi même : il y a bien une configuration à prévoir, qui n'est pas faite par les dépendances comme je le pensais. je l'ai trouvée sur :

http://tvaira.free.fr/rfid/tutoriel-nfc-acr122u.pdf
extrait :

Code : Tout sélectionner

sudo apt-get install pcsc-tools pcscd
sudo apt-get install libpcsclite-dev
sudo apt-get install libpcsclite1
sudo apt-get install libusb-dev 
j'ai maintenant la LED rouge allumée, mais pas d'inclusion possible, le lecteur ne réagit pas

une bonne âme svp?

merci

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 02 nov. 2018, 20:12
par Seb54
petit up

@lunarok, selon toi, probleme jeedom ou raspberry?
ci joint pour info le log des dep (log node et nfc vides)
log DEP NFC.txt
(3.03 Kio) Téléchargé 102 fois
Qqn a réussi à faire fonctionner le plugin avec un autre matériel que le ACR122?

merci :D

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 11 nov. 2018, 13:25
par Seb54
up svp, je ne trouve d'infos nulle part ailleurs que sur ce fil

merci

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 16 nov. 2018, 22:20
par Seb54
up svp, quelqu'un utilise autre chose qu'un ACR122 pour du NFC sur Jeedom ?

merci

Re: [Plugin Tiers][Sujet Principal] NFC : lecteur d'UID NFC/RFID

Publié : 10 déc. 2018, 21:19
par Seb54
up up up?
up up up!